    I actually did a whole research paper and project on this; the theory is that the energy from the Big Crunch will spark another Big Bang, thus starting the cycle over and over again.

    Because if you think about it, the entire universe coming together (billions and billions of stars and planets), that is a tremendous amount of energy that can be transferred, so based on the law that energy cannot be created or destroyed, the energy from the collapse could simply be transferred to an explosion that essentially "restarts" the universe.
